Yes, that should be enough. Other than that, the labels are nothing else than "names" to the HMM. You will find them in the mono and full phone lists.

You should also be careful that some special characters could be interpreted by the system, or screw up questions parsing.

To avoid this, I did replace all "content" special characters (phonemes, POS, etc.) such as to use only alphanumeric characters.

       I'm trying to generate a new label set that used our own prosodic features for the clustering. However, this implies to modify other things probably.

       Can someone tell me what would be the implications of modifying the label format? I mean, how many times in the code this format is assumed. Because for me it looks like changing the question list should be enough, but I am not sure of it.
